The Conceptual Structure of the Mental Aspects of Spiritual Care Based on the Quranic Verses and Narrations

Abstract

Background and Objective: Spirituality and spiritual care are the inseparable part of holistic care and attention to its mental and spiritual aspects can have an important role in patients’ recovery and reaching the health goals. The concept of spiritual care has received serious attention in the religious, psychological, and medical areas. Attention to the conceptual structure of spiritual care helps to determine its indexes based on the vivid Islamic point of view. Accordingly, the present study is an attempt to examine the conceptual structure of the mental aspects of spiritual care based on the Quranic verses and narrations.

Methods: The present study is descriptive-analytical and library-based study. For this purpose, the spiritual and psychological dimensions of spiritual care in Islamic religious texts (Quranic verses and hadiths), were examined in the Qur'an and Islamic sources using the software of the digital library of Isra’ and the Tadbar website (Islamic Sciences and Education Foundation), especially the written works of Ayatollah Javadi Amoli, The Tafsir-e Nemouneh by Ayatollah Makarem Shirazi and Tuhfat ul-Oghul (the gift of the intellect). The authors of the article reported no conflict of interests.

Results: The results showed that the mental aspect of spiritual care includes 4 sub-scales of self-compatibility, efficient beliefs in the compatibility with issues, having a spirit of criticism, and having a good performance in dealing with problems. Furthermore, the mental aspect of spiritual care includes 4 sub-scales of human relationship with God, yourself, others, and nature.

Conclusion: Attention to the mental aspect of spiritual care can help to accept and comply with the existing conditions and even the patient’s death. Therefore, the members of the health team should be acquainted with these concepts and make it easier to tolerate the pain caused by the disease by providing proper care.
